TomTom GO 510 / GO 520 Series — 3.7V Li-ion Replacement Battery (AHA11110004)

This is a 3.7V, 1100mAh Li-ion cell that fits the TomTom GO 510, GO 520, GO 520 WiFi, and related 4FA50-series portable GPS navigators. It replaces OEM part AHA11110004 directly. Capacity matches the original spec — 4.07Wh total energy.

  • GO 510 / GO 520 platform fit: These models share the same battery bay dimensions, 3.7V supply rail, and connector orientation. The BMS handshake on this cell communicates state-of-charge data back to the GO navigator's power management IC, so the on-screen battery indicator reads correctly from the first charge cycle.
  • Bench tested on actual hardware: We cycled this cell through full charge and discharge on a GO 510 unit. The BMS held the cutoff at the expected low-voltage threshold and did not trip during screen-on navigation with GPS active. No false low-battery flags appeared during testing.
  • Cold-start satellite acquisition after installation: After fitting this cell and powering the device on for the first time outdoors, allow the GO to complete a full cold-start satellite fix before driving. The navigator loses its ephemeris data on full power removal, so the first fix after a battery swap typically takes 5–10 minutes in open sky — subsequent warm starts return to under a minute.

GPS accuracy reduced at low battery on the GO 510

The GO 510 receiver section draws more current than the display during active navigation. When cell voltage drops toward 3.5V, the device's power management begins throttling the GPS receiver to protect the remaining charge. This reduction in receiver sensitivity means position fixes become less frequent and accuracy degrades before the device shows a low-battery warning. Keeping the cell above 3.6V during use avoids this behaviour entirely.

GO 510 shuts off without warning before the battery indicator hits zero

This is a calibration issue between the new cell and the fuel gauge IC. The GO 510 carries over its charge-state estimate from the old, degraded battery, so the percentage shown on screen no longer matches actual cell voltage. The device hits the hardware low-voltage cutoff — typically around 3.3V — while the indicator still shows 15–20% remaining. Run two full charge-to-discharge cycles and the gauge recalibrates to the new cell's actual capacity curve.

Frequently Asked Questions

My TomTom GO 510 lost all my saved routes after I swapped the battery — is that normal?

Yes. The GO 510 stores saved routes and some user data in battery-backed RAM, and a full power interruption during a battery swap clears that volatile memory. Favourites and home/work addresses stored in non-volatile flash are usually retained, but active route history and recently found POIs are commonly lost. After fitting the new cell, re-enter any critical saved routes before your next journey.

My GO 520 is taking 8 minutes to find a satellite fix after the battery replacement — is something wrong with the new cell?

Nothing is wrong. When the battery is removed, the GO 520 loses its cached almanac and ephemeris data — the satellite timing tables it uses for a fast lock. Without that cache, the receiver has to rebuild its satellite map from scratch, which takes 5–10 minutes outdoors with a clear sky view. Subsequent power cycles warm-start from the rebuilt cache and lock in under a minute.

My GO 510 drains noticeably faster when I'm actively navigating compared to just sitting on the dashboard — why?

Active navigation runs the GPS receiver, map rendering, and display simultaneously, which pulls significantly more current than standby. On a 1100mAh cell at 3.7V, display brightness has the single largest impact — drop the screen brightness one or two steps in Settings and the drain rate falls measurably. If the device is also recalculating routes frequently in weak GPS signal areas, the receiver draw increases further; a windscreen mount with a clear sky view reduces that load.
